On May 18, 2026, the Association of Banks in Cambodia (ABC), together with the Cambodia Microfinance Association (CMA) and the International Labour Organization (ILO), officially announced the training program on "Financial Education for Banking and Financial Institutions" in Phnom Penh.

The inauguration ceremony was attended by Mr. Rath Sophoan, Chairman of the Association of Banks in Cambodia(ABC); Mr. Tun Sophorn, National Coordinator of the International Labour Organization (ILO); Mr. Sok Voeun, Chairman of the Cambodia Microfinance Association (CMA); and Ms. Froukje Boele, Country Programme Manager of the Better Factories Cambodia (ILO-BFC), along with the presence of banking and financial institutions, trainees, as well as representatives from financial institutions and journalists about 60 people.

It should also be noted that this training program is part of the ILO Global Programme on Financial Education, which aims to promote financial literacy and financial inclusion through capacity building and vocational training. After completing the training, the 20 master trainers from banking and financial institutions will continue to disseminate and provide further training within their institutions and communities to help Cambodian people become more knowledgeable and skilled in managing their personal finances, especially in making informed financial decisions and using financial services effectively in the growing digital economic context.

At the same time, Mr. Kok Tha, CEO of FHF Capital Plc., participated as an official candidate among the 20 outstanding master trainers who were carefully selected from various financial institutions, and this training session lasts for 5 full days.

This important initiative demonstrates the joint commitment of the financial sector and relevant stakeholders in strengthening professional capacity across the Cambodian banking and financial sector, as well as supporting Cambodia's efforts in promoting financial inclusion, customer protection, and responsible financial service provision.
